Важная информация

User Tag List

Страница 1 из 4 1234 ПоследняяПоследняя
Показано с 1 по 10 из 35

Тема: sjasmplus от z00m

  1. #1
    Master
    Регистрация
    31.01.2007
    Адрес
    Москва
    Сообщений
    555
    Благодарностей: 533
    Mentioned
    5 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ию sjasmplus от z00m

    Альтернативная ветка от чехов нашего любимого кросс-асма.

    https://github.com/z00m128/sjasmplus/releases

    Достаточно часто обновляется со вкусными релиз нотами.

    sjasmplus v1.11.0

    Added ZX Spectrum Next instructions support
    Added --msg option, directives DG and DH
    Changed listing layout to fixed-width type
    Errors, Warnings and similar are now channeled to STDERR
    Fixed string literal parser, added two apostrophes and escaped zero
    Fixed docs templates (HTML is now more valid)
    Fixed nesting DUP issue
    Fixed CRLF handling in parser
    Fixed -D option for multiple asm files
    Fixed address display when the 64kB limit exceeded
    Fixed lost code when current memory leaves device slot in "disp" mode
    Fixed IF inside MACRO, DUP and REPT
    Fixed ALIGN behavior and docs wording
    Fixed INCHOB/INCBIN (offset / length)
    Fixed INCLUDE/INCLUDELUA system path priority ("" vs <>)
    Fixed END behavior
    Fixed DEFARRAY to work as documented
    Fixed and refactored WORD/DWORD/D24
    Fixed and extended STRUCT
    Multiple bugfixes in listing generation
    Multiple bugfixes of internal code
    Refactored options parser, instruction parser and Warning/Error system
    C++14 standard is now required minimum (to compile sjasmplus sources)
    Added automated-testing scripts, with 50+ tests
    GitHub connected with Cirrus Continuous Integration service

    sjasmplus v1.11.1

    Fixed global labels in MACRO and in IFUSED/IFNUSED
    Fixed nested IF-DUP-IF
    Fixed local labels fail when amount of lines did change between passes
    Fixed Makefile to build when path to project contains space
    Added macro-example: turn "DJNZ ." into "DJNZ $" (to fix Zeus syntax source)
    Added --msg=lst and --msg=lstlab options to produce listing file to STDERR
    Added options to read input file from STDIN and output "raw" binary to STDOUT

  2. Эти 3 пользователя(ей) поблагодарили krt17 за это полезное сообщение:
    mastermind (05.04.2019), NEO SPECTRUMAN (03.04.2019), zebest (03.04.2019)

  3. #1
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  4. #2
    Master Аватар для zebest
    Регистрация
    11.01.2008
    Адрес
    Ладошкино
    Сообщений
    872
    Благодарностей: 608
    Записей в дневнике
    3
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    хы, .SCL без ошибок компилит. Уже нравиЦЦа.
    Profi v3.2 -=- Speccy2010,r2

  5. #3
    Guru Аватар для NEO SPECTRUMAN
    Регистрация
    22.05.2011
    Адрес
    Дзержинск
    Сообщений
    2,422
    Благодарностей: 408
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    печально что не отечественная ветка

  6. #4
    Master Аватар для Bedazzle
    Регистрация
    02.05.2015
    Адрес
    г. Таллин, Эстония
    Сообщений
    795
    Благодарностей: 154
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от NEO SPECTRUMAN Посмотреть сообщение
    печально что не отечественная ветка
    Какая разница, кто поднял упавший флаг, если несёт достойно?

  7. #5
    Guru Аватар для NEO SPECTRUMAN
    Регистрация
    22.05.2011
    Адрес
    Дзержинск
    Сообщений
    2,422
    Благодарностей: 408
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Bedazzle Посмотреть сообщение
    Какая разница, кто поднял упавший флаг, если несёт достойно?
    некому писать пожилания и угрозы
    а ищо вроде есть жо наша отечественная ветка (которая должна была фсех победить)

    - - - Добавлено - - -

    и вообще будем надеятсо что настанет тот день
    когда sjasm ВНЕЗАПНО закомпилирует сорцы аласма
    Последний раз редактировалось NEO SPECTRUMAN; 04.04.2019 в 01:59.

  8. #6
    Master Аватар для Bedazzle
    Регистрация
    02.05.2015
    Адрес
    г. Таллин, Эстония
    Сообщений
    795
    Благодарностей: 154
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от krt17 Посмотреть сообщение
    Альтернативная ветка от чехов нашего любимого кросс-асма.
    Код:
    		ld      a, '\\'
    В других верисиях ок, эта вываливает предупреждение (полученный бинарник, правда, правильный)


  9. #7
    Guru Аватар для Shiny
    Регистрация
    19.01.2017
    Адрес
    г. Арзамас
    Сообщений
    2,010
    Благодарностей: 912
    Записей в дневнике
    36
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    все повторы по старинке через DUP/REPT
    в Storm'e было после .4 - удобнее.
    Украшу собой любой черный список
    TR-DOS cracktros

  10. #8
    Guru Аватар для Shiny
    Регистрация
    19.01.2017
    Адрес
    г. Арзамас
    Сообщений
    2,010
    Благодарностей: 912
    Записей в дневнике
    36
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    с системными переменными та же шляпа со 128
    Украшу собой любой черный список
    TR-DOS cracktros

  11. #9
    Activist
    Регистрация
    21.08.2009
    Адрес
    Cyprus
    Сообщений
    205
    Благодарностей: 86
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Печально что эти парни взяли за основу древнейший код, незаметив "основную", более новую ветку, которую правил @Vitamin и позже я. Во многом заново наступают на/правят те же самые грабли, древнейший код.

    - - - Добавлено - - -

    Цитата Сообщение от NEO SPECTRUMAN Посмотреть сообщение
    некому писать пожилания и угрозы
    а ищо вроде есть жо наша отечественная ветка (которая должна была фсех победить)
    Да вот действительно, вспоминается анекдот про "ты хотя бы лотерейный билет купи". Уж сколько раз я предлагал писать запросы/багрепорты в issues. Один @asve79 что-то пишет иногда, а больше никому ничего не нужно судя по всему.

    - - - Добавлено - - -

    и вообще будем надеятсо что настанет тот день
    когда sjasm ВНЕЗАПНО закомпилирует сорцы аласма
    А это зачем нужно? Аласмовские сорцы токенизированные же? Чем их редактировать на PC?
    Последний раз редактировалось mastermind; 05.04.2019 в 19:22.

  12. #10
    Guru Аватар для Shiny
    Регистрация
    19.01.2017
    Адрес
    г. Арзамас
    Сообщений
    2,010
    Благодарностей: 912
    Записей в дневнике
    36
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от mastermind Посмотреть сообщение
    А это зачем нужно? Аласмовские сорцы токенизированные же? Чем их редактировать на PC?
    А ничем. От специфического синтаксиса можно чокнуться

    не понравилось, что при компиляции вылезает сообщение об include/incbin
    Украшу собой любой черный список
    TR-DOS cracktros

Страница 1 из 4 1234 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. SjASMPlus Z80 кросс ассемблер
    от Aprisobal в разделе Программирование
    Ответов: 1588
    Последнее: 18.04.2019, 15:03
  2. Исходники TR-DOS для SjASMPlus
    от Keeper в разделе Программирование
    Ответов: 20
    Последнее: 11.02.2011, 12:57
  3. Запуск STS из .sna, сгенерированного sjasmplus.
    от siril в разделе Программирование
    Ответов: 7
    Последнее: 11.10.2010, 21:33
  4. Breakpoints в связке Sjasmplus+UnrealSpeccy
    от Kurles в разделе Программирование
    Ответов: 19
    Последнее: 26.01.2009, 13:36
  5. Disturbed COverMAnia ( music disk with z00m music collection)
    от kyv в разделе Музыка
    Ответов: 10
    Последнее: 27.03.2008, 11:01

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•